Best practice per la migrazione dei dati
Questa sezione fornisce consigli su come accelerare e semplificare la migrazione e indicazioni sul tempo necessario.
-
Utilizzare una copia del database da un'istanza del Magento 1 durante l’esecuzione dei test di migrazione. Non utilizzare l'istanza di produzione del database dell'archivio di Magento 1.
-
Rimuovere i dati obsoleti e ridondanti dal database del Magento 1 prima della migrazione.
Tali dati possono includere registri, preventivi d’ordine, prodotti visualizzati o confrontati di recente, visitatori, categorie specifiche dell’evento e regole promozionali.
-
Per migliorare le prestazioni, abilita
direct_document_copy
opzione nel tuoconfig.xml
file:code language-xml <direct_document_copy>1</direct_document_copy>
NOTE
I database del Magento 1 e del Magento 2 devono trovarsi sullo stesso server MySQL e l'account del database deve avere accesso a entrambi i database.
Stime di benchmarking
Adobe ha testato la migrazione dei dati sul seguente sistema:
- Virtual Box VM, CentOS 6, 2,5 GB di RAM, CPU 1 core 2,6 GHz
- Database con 177.000 prodotti, 355.000 ordini e 214.000 clienti
Risultati delle prestazioni
- Tempo di migrazione delle impostazioni: circa 10 minuti
- Tempo di migrazione dei dati: circa 9 ore (tutti i dati tranne le riscritture URL, circa l’85% dei dati totali)
- Stima dei tempi di inattività del sito: alcuni minuti per reindicizzare e modificare le impostazioni DNS. Tempo aggiuntivo necessario per riscaldare la cache delle pagine.
recommendation-more-help
c2d96e17-5179-455c-ad3a-e1697bb4e8c3